They are beautiful. But you were actually right in saying dangerous window blind sord. You should remove the plastic ends of the blind cords as they can cause a hazard to your cat. One of our members here can attest to that. Uabassoon had a very scary and costly operation done for her kitty due to said kitty ingesting and getting stuck one of those plastic ends. So in your cats best interest please remove them.
